The Internet of Things (IoT) is changing how we monitor and control devices in our daily lives. Think of a smart thermostat that automatically adjusts your home's temperature, or a refrigerator that alerts you when food is running out. IoT does this and much more, connecting devices to the internet to collect and exchange data in real time.

This technology is vital for areas where continuous monitoring is crucial, such as vaccine storage or food. For example, if the temperature in a vaccine warehouse begins to rise, IoT sensors can send immediate alerts to correct the problem before vaccines are affected. This ensures quality and safety, preventing waste and losses.

Among the main benefits of IoT are:

  • Real-Time Data Collection: Network-connected sensors enable instant data collection, facilitating rapid problem identification.
  • Reduction of Human Error: With automation, IoT minimizes the need for manual monitoring, making data more accurate and reliable.
  • Operational Efficiency: Automating processes through IoT saves time and resources, making operations faster and more effective.
  • Proactive Alerts: IoT sends real-time notifications, enabling quick action to prevent larger problems.

These benefits make IoT a powerful tool in managing sensitive supplies. With continuous and accurate monitoring, companies are better prepared to prevent losses and ensure product safety. Artificial Intelligence (AI) is changing the way we do business, especially when it comes to predictive data analysis. But what does this mean in practice? Think of AI as a superintelligent assistant that analyzes a huge pile of information to help you make smarter decisions.

For example, imagine you have a cold storage room full of vaccines. Maintaining the right temperature is crucial. If something goes wrong, you could lose everything. With AI, it's possible to predict when equipment might fail. The system analyzes temperature and humidity data, and if something is out of the ordinary, it alerts you before a problem occurs. This gives you time to act, preventing losses.

Beyond preventing failures, AI helps discover ideal conditions for storing different products. If a specific vaccine begins to degrade at a certain temperature, AI can adjust systems to prevent this from happening. This ensures products remain safe and effective for longer.

The benefits of this technology are many. First, it helps reduce costs by avoiding unpleasant surprises and emergency expenses. Additionally, decision-making becomes easier and more accurate, as you have clear data and reliable predictions right in your hands. All of this makes systems more reliable and efficient, resulting in better use of available resources.
